Montezuma Well is a limestone sinkhole in central Arizona, but it’s much more than that. It’s a constant source of water in the desert, for one. The Yavapai people believe they emerged into this world from within the Well. It is their ancestor. It reveals some of the history of previous civilizations. It harbors a […]
